Have you avoided a difficult conversation in the last month that you knew you should have had? For most of us, that answer is Yes. Why is that? Because it’s scary and uncomfortable? Probably, but it shouldn’t be. Every avoided difficult conversation becomes more expensive over time—in lost productivity, damaged relationships, and missed opportunities. I’m a professional mediator who helps people turn those conversations into opportunities. Learn how to raise hard issues at work or home with confidence and curiosity. You’ll leave with strategies you can use immediately to reduce tension, build trust and move forward. ABOUT THE PRESENTER: Caroline Melkonian ’86 is a professional mediator based in the Capital District. She specializes in divorce, family, and workplace conflict resolution. Prior to founding her mediation practice, Caroline Melkonian Mediation, Caroline served as a labor negotiator for the State of New York, where she negotiated and administered terms and conditions of employment for more than 50,000 state employees and health insurance benefits for over one million state and local employees. With more than 20 years of experience navigating complex disputes, Caroline draws on her background in negotiation and mediation to help individuals and organizations identify underlying interests, communicate more effectively, and reach agreements that allow them to move forward with clarity and confidence.
